How much do remote dental receptionist j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ote dental receptionist in Boca Raton, FL is $17.72,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.00 and $19.81 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ote dental receptionist?

A Remote Dental Receptionist manages front desk duties for a dental office from a remote location. Responsibilities include scheduling appointments, handling patient inquiries, processing billing, and managing records using digital systems. Strong communication, organizational skills, and familiarity with dental software are essential. This role allows dental offices to streamline operations while providing patients with efficient support.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ote dental receptionist?

To thrive as a Remote Dental Receptionist, you need a strong background in administrative support, appointment scheduling, and dental office procedures, often backed by experience in healthcare or dental settings. Familiarity with dental practice management software, phone systems, and secure patient communication platforms is typically expected. Excellent interpersonal skills, attention to detail, and the ability to multitask effectively in a virtual environment are highly valued. These competencies are vital for ensuring efficient office operations, positive patient experiences, and seamless coordination among team members while working remotely.

What are some common challenges faced by remote dental receptionists, and how can they be addressed?

Remote dental receptionists often face challenges such as managing high call volumes, resolving patient concerns efficiently from a distance, and ensuring clear communication between patients and dental staff. Staying organized and making use of digital tools like scheduling software and secure messaging platforms can help streamline daily tasks. Proactively establishing strong routines, maintaining clear documentation, and regularly checking in with the dental team are key to overcoming these hurdles. Employers may also provide training and support to ensure remote receptionists are fully integrated and equipped for success. With the right approach and resources, remote dental receptionists can enjoy a rewarding and collaborative work experience.
